I modified the spices a bit since I didn't have any all spice at home. I got about 18 meatballs but it all depends on how big you make them I guess. I made mine quite medium sized I think.
Ingredients
500 g mince meat
1 small onion
2 garlic cloves
1 tbsp dijon mustard
½ tsp turmeric
½ tsp paprika powder
1½ tsp salt
½ tsp cracked black pepper
3 tbsp finely chopped fresh flat leaf parsley (or as much as you prefer)
1½ tbsp butter for frying
Put the mince meat in a bowl. Finely chop the onion and garlic, either by hand or using a food processor. Add the onion and garlic to the mince and mix around thoroughly with your hands. When mixed well, add the dijon, spices and parsley. Mix once again until completely combined. Roll the mince meat mix into round balls. Fry them in the butter on medium heat for about 8 minutes or until cooked through.
